> Hi Tim
>=20
> I'm no expert so can only share personal experiences.  I have a couple
of=
unbranded units from CPC, one powered and one passive (which were =C2=A340=
and =C2=A320 respectively from memory) and they were fine for quite a whil=
e. They are both 2 cable units and were run from what was effectively long
=
patch leads under the floor ie no breaks for patch panels or wall plates.
>=20
> Then after a house rewire, patch panels and new sources (a dune media
pla=
yer that runs at up to 1080p 60hz and 12 bit colour) I found I could no
lon=
ger run at max resolutions. The symptom was either no picture or single
gre=
en pixels dotted over the screen.  All was fine if I dropped 'down' to
25hz=
for example.
>=20
> Having located all my kit in node 0 and a possibly misguided view that
I =
needed 60hz, failure was not an option so my next port of call was some
mor=
e expensive CYP units from richer sounds (circa =C2=A3100 I think) but I
go=
t the same result.
>=20
> The situation was now getting a touch embarrassing with 'er indoors so
as=
a last roll of the dice I threw yet more money at it and bought some 'chea=
p' HDbaseT units (from CPC, Scan had some cheaper ones but they were
perman=
ently on back order).  I'm pleased to say they just work. Only powered at
t=
he sender end so no need for bulky wall adaptor behind the
